摘要

In this article a mixed convection of homogenous gas in a rectangular closed area is investigated. A gas stream is blown through a slot in the center on the lateral surface. To describe the considered stream, an equation system is derived from the Nawie-Stocks model for compressable gas at opproaching hypersonic motion. For internal body a head convectivity equation is used. Satterland formula is used on dynamic viseous coefficient. The problem presented above is solved numerically with a method enabling to apply implicit schemes of alternative directions for the solution of the system of the equations. The main reults of the calculations are given grafically and relevant conclusions are made.
